#544b45 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#544b45 is composed of 32.9% red, 29.4%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.7% magenta, 17.9%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 24 degrees, a saturation of 9.8% and a lightness of 30%. #544b45 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8968a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#544b45

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090807 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#544b45

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e4c4b is the less saturated color, while #953e04 is the most saturated one.
